Understanding the Landscape of Metaverse Vietnam Companies
Vietnam’s rapid internet penetration and increasing mobile user base stand at the core of the blockchain and Metaverse growth. As of 2023, there are approximately 70 million internet users in Vietnam, representing a national internet penetration rate of around 70%. Coupled with a growing youth population, this digital-savvy demographic creates a fertile ground for Metaverse innovations.

Investment Trends and Future Projections
In 2023, over $300 million was invested in Vietnamese startups focused on Metaverse and related technologies. By 2025, projections indicate that the Metaverse could contribute approximately 5% to Vietnam’s GDP, underscoring its importance.
